Summary Potentiometric and spectroscopic measurements were used to characterize the binding ability of -hydroxy-methylserine (Hms) with copper(II) and oxovanadium(IV) ions. The ligand was found to be generally a more efficient chelating agent than serine. Both of the deprotonated hydroxyl groups of Hms can be involved in coordination to vanadyl ions, whereas copper(II) binds in the same way as with serine.  相似文献

Heats of formation (ΔHf) and proton affinities (PA) of 2-, 3-, and 4-monosubstituted pyridines in the gas phase are calculated using the AM1 and PM3 semiempirical methods. The following substitutents are considered: NO2, CN, CF3, CHO, F, Cl, COCH3, H, CH3, OCH3, SCH3, NH2, and N(CH3)2. The results are compared with the experimental data. Both methods reproduce the ΔHf with comparble accuracy; the rms deviations are 4.1 (AM1) and 4.5 kcal/mol (PM3) for the free bases and 9.5 (AM1) and 9.7 kcal/mol (PM3) for their conjugated acids. The PA are systematically underestimated by both methods, but AM1 appears to be clearly better than PM3 for reproducing the experimental values. The rms deviations for AM1 and PM3 are 5.1 and 9.6 kcal/mol, respectively. This is due to a cancellation of systematic errors in the calculated ΔHf in the AM1 case and to a summation of the errors in the PM3 case. Both methods correctly reproduce conformations of the molecules under consideration.  相似文献

Reaction of chloranilic acid with N-methylpiperidine in acetonitrile has been studied. The product of the reaction is an unusually stable anion radical of quinone. The presence of radicals has been confirmed by EPR measurements. Stability constant, extinction coefficients and thermodynamic reaction parameters are reported. Mechanism of the reaction is proposed. The pyrolysis of samples containing copper, lead, iron, sulphur compounds and organic carbon is applied to separate mercury prior to its determination by a.a.s. Amalgamation on gold collectors followed by thermal desorption, or trapping in an absorption solution followed by reduction/aeration were used depending on the mercury content in the materials. Appropriate additives to the samples and filters are used to ensure complete release of mercury and removal of interfering pyrolysis products.  相似文献

We propose a class of nonlinear integro-differential equations that at the mesoscopic level models the competition between a tumor and the immune system. The model describes the evolution of a distribution function of the microscopic parameter referred to as activity of cells. The idea is somehow similar to the Enskog theory in kinetic theory. By averaging with respect to the parameter, the mesoscopic class of models reduces to the general class of macroscopic models introduced by A. d’Onofrio that may assess the effect of delays in stimulation of the immune system by tumor cells. The existence and uniqueness theory is developed.  相似文献

The main objective of this article is to present the authors' view of and results on non-linear lateral stability of rail vehicles in a curved track. Three elements are exploited in order to secure this objective. Firstly, physical genesis of the problem is discussed, and its similarity to straight track analysis is emphasised. Results of the theories of self-exciting vibrations and bifurcation are the key elements here. Secondly, the method suitable for analysis in a curved track is presented. New necessary elements, extending the better established methods for straight track are clearly mentioned and described. The methodology of building original stability maps, being the basis for the analysis and valid for whole range of curve radii and straight track is represented. Thirdly, a sample of the analysis is shown in order to give the idea how the method can be utilised. The case study refers to the influence of wheel/rail profiles on the stability in circularly curved track and straight track as well. Two different pairs of wheel/rail profiles are used and the corresponding results compared. The main contributions of the article are: a discussion of the physical nature of phenomena related to the stability in a curved tracks, and the method (procedure) established for the reasons of the analysis. Another and more general contribution is our say in the hot polemics on the advisability of stability analysis in curves and the advantages of the non-linear critical speed over the linear one.  相似文献

A new upconversion nanocrystal phase Yb2Mo4O15:Er is developed by using a facile aqueous‐precipitation procedure combined with thermal annealing. Nanocrystals of Yb2Mo4O15 are exclusively synthesized, with particle sizes ranging from 1 to 20 nm. The optical properties are characterized and a high upconversion quantum yield is determined to be ≈1.3% at room temperature, under excitation of ≈500 mW cm?2 IR (975 nm). To the best of our knowledge, this is the first work concerning the synthesis of nanocrystalline Yb2Mo4O15 and the characterization of its upconversion properties, which possesses the potential to be utilized in bio‐probing and thin‐film optoelectronic device applications.  相似文献

In this work we demonstrate the properties of spatial solitary waves in chiral nematic liquid crystals with an external electric field. Such self-trapped beams, called nematicons, were created due to the optical reorientation nonlinearity for a light power of a few tens of milliwatts. We show that the direction of propagation of such nematicons can be changed by applying an external electric field. Additionally, this effect can be modified by changing the input polarization of the light beam. The experimental results were obtained in four independent guiding layers created by a chiral nematic structure.  相似文献

We prove the existence of C0 semigroups related to some birth-and-death type infinite systems of ODEs with possibly unbounded coefficients, in the scale of spaces lp, For some particular cases we also provide a characterization of the spectra of their generators. For the proof of the generation theorem in the case p > 1 we extend the Chernoff perturbation result ([9]) on relatively bounded perturbations of generators. The results presented here have been used in [5] and they play important role for analysing chaoticity of dynamical systems considered there. As a by-product of our approach we obtain a result related to the classical Shubin theorem [20]. We show that this theorem, saying that for a class of bounded infinite matrices the spectrum of the corresponding maximal operator in lp is independent on cannot be extended to unbounded matrices.  相似文献

Contributions to the Chemistry of Transition Metal Alkyl Compounds. XIII. the Reaction of Vanadium Isopropyl Ester with Dimethyl Zinc. — On the Formation of CH3VO(i-OC3H7)2 Dimethyl zinc reacts with ortho vanadium acid triisopropyl ester forming methyl zinc isopropoxide (CH3Zn-i-OC3H7)n and methyl vanadium oxide diisopropoxide CH3VO(i-OC3H7)2. The new σ-organovanadium compound was isolated and thoroughly characterized.  相似文献
